The Shattered Glass Project (TSGP) presents the West Coast premiere of All New Cells, written by Aliza Goldstein and directed by Alison Kozar, June 2-18, 2023 at Theatre Off Jackson. A powerful story of disconnection and a search for identity contrasting how we live IRL (in real life) and how we present to the online world, All New Cells is TSGP’s second fully-mounted production.

Featuring Kasper Cergol (he/him) as Nils; Zenaida Rose Smith (they/them) as Lux; Jasmine Lomax (they/them) as Aeon; and Kay Taylor Yelinek (they/them) as Moody, All New Cells will preview June 1 and run June 2-18, 2023 at Theatre Off Jackson, located at 409 7th Ave. S, Seattle WA 98104. All New Cells centers on Nils, a young trans man. When Nils's ex-girlfriend dies suddenly, he is dragged back into a toxic online roleplay scene he swore he'd never return to. He'd been doing okay sticking to his seven-year plan for getting over their breakup - but now, everyone either blames him or expects him to have answers, and he's getting nasty anonymous messages that might be coming from beyond the grave. A nuanced examination of identity, trauma, assault, grief, and mental health through an online world.

CONTENT NOTE: All New Cells  contains references to suicide, child sexual abuse and self harm, which are discussed but not depicted; themes include transphobia and online bullying.

Alison Kozar (they/them), a Seattle-based stage manager, sound designer and cohort member in TSGP’s 2021 Incubator/Mentor Program for emerging directors and playwrights connected with Aliza Goldstein (she/they), a playwright based in Orange County, CA, through the New Play Exchange, and brought All New Cells to TSGP as part of the company’s 2021 Zoom-based script development series.

The importance of role-play gaming and the construction of new personalities in new bodies is woven through the fabric of Nils’ story and personal development, as is the theme of creating power for and over yourself in a world where people often feel powerless.  All New Cells touches on the way in which the digital ghosts of our past come back to haunt us. Ultimately, as Nils’ story shows, we can find agency for ourselves in a digital world and carry that agency into the life we live in the real world. We have the power to redefine ourselves.


TSGP is a theatre company with a mission to amplify the voices of theatre artists who have been marginalized on the basis of their gender or sex by offering unique opportunities to create and grow professionally. Programming includes an online developmental reading series bringing emerging directors together with new scripts; and the Director and Playwright Incubator/Mentor Program, a professional development program building community and relationships between gender-marginalized theatre artists.
